The role of cognitive biases in gambling

Cognitive biases significantly shape decision-making in casino environments. One prevalent bias is the illusion of control, where players believe they can influence the outcome of random games. This belief can lead to reckless betting and a misunderstanding of odds. Gamblers often feel a false sense of confidence, which can skew their financial decisions and lead to greater losses.

Another common bias is the gambler’s fallacy, where players assume that past outcomes will affect future results. For instance, a player may believe that after a series of losses, they are “due” for a win. This flawed reasoning can lead to continued gambling despite losses, perpetuating a cycle of poor decision-making and financial strain.

The effects of rewards and reinforcement in gambling

Rewards play a crucial role in shaping behavior within the casino setting. The immediate gratification from wins, no matter how small, serves as reinforcement that can encourage continued gambling behavior. This concept is rooted in behavioral psychology, where rewards can condition players to return to the gaming floor in pursuit of further victories.

The intermittent rewards provided by slot machines and other games create anticipation and excitement, which can lead to addictive behaviors. Players may find themselves chasing the high of a win, often disregarding the risks involved. Understanding how these psychological rewards function is vital for recognizing the detrimental impact they can have on decision-making in casino gameplay.
